Al Qaeda uses several online magazines to broadcast its strategy to massive audiences. In Sawt al-Jihad (Voice of Jihad), an article’s author focuses on mobilizing Muslims to commit jihad. In another online magazine, Mu'askar al-Battar (Camp of the Sword), an article covered online recruiting and suggested that new members should remain in their local surroundings after being recruited. With the guidelines of telling new members to remain in place, this allows Al Qaeda the ability to commit future acts of terrorism. This group also has online supporters that operate autonomously, further distribute links to sites and propaganda, and maintain loosely aligned sites that produce lower quality propaganda.
